Wasps typically die off in the fall as the weather gets colder. During this time, the worker wasps die, leaving behind only the queen wasps. The queen wasps find shelter to hibernate in over the winter, emerging in the spring to start new colonies. So, the end of summer into the fall is when you’ll see a decrease in wasp activity as they begin to die off.

The Lifespan of Worker Wasps
Worker wasps play a crucial role in the day-to-day operations of a wasp colony.
These non-reproductive females are responsible for tasks such as building and repairing the nest, foraging for food, caring for the larvae, and defending the colony.
– Researchers have found that the lifespan of a worker wasp is relatively short, usually ranging from a few weeks to a few months.
– Unlike the queen wasp, whose lifespan can extend up to a year, worker wasps are focused on maintaining the colony’s functionality and survival.

Stocking Up for the Winter
Before hibernating, the queen must ensure she has enough resources to sustain her through the cold months.
In preparation, she feeds voraciously on carbohydrates to build up fat reserves that will provide energy during hibernation.
This behavior is crucial for her survival, as she will not leave the hibernation site until the temperatures are conducive to begin building a new colony.
Choosing the Perfect Hibernation Spot
Queens are meticulous in selecting their hibernation spot.
They seek out sheltered locations such as hollow trees, attics, or underground burrows to protect themselves from the harsh winter conditions.
These spots provide insulation and security, allowing the queen to conserve energy and survive until spring.

Reproductive Cycle
Another factor that plays a role in the timing of wasp deaths is the reproductive cycle of the colony.
Towards the end of the summer, the focus shifts from foraging for food to producing new queens and males, which are essential for the continuation of the colony.
Once this reproductive phase is complete, the worker wasps, having fulfilled their duties, start to die off.

3. Seal Potential Entry Points
Wasps can enter buildings through tiny openings and gaps.
To deter them from nesting inside your home or structure, seal off any potential entry points.
Use caulk to fill in cracks, install screens on windows, and ensure that doors close tightly.
By taking these preventive measures, you can minimize the chances of a wasp infestation.
4. Plant Wasp-Repellent Plants
Certain plants and herbs naturally repel wasps due to their scent or properties.
Examples include mint, eucalyptus, and wormwood.
By strategically planting these around your outdoor living spaces, you can create a natural barrier that deters wasps from making nests nearby.
This eco-friendly approach is not only effective but also adds beauty to your surroundings.
5. Avoid Sweet Scents and Bright Colors
Wasps are attracted to sweet scents and bright colors, which they associate with sources of food.
To reduce the likelihood of attracting them, avoid wearing strong perfumes or brightly colored clothing when spending time outdoors.
Additionally, keep food and beverages covered, especially during peak wasp activity months.
